Google Cloud RunA comprehensive managed compute platform designed to rapidly and securely deploy and scale containerized applications. Developers can utilize their preferred programming languages such as Go, Python, Java, Ruby, Node.js, and others. By eliminating the need for infrastructure management, the platform ensures a seamless experience for developers. It is based on the open standard Knative, which facilitates the portability of applications across different environments. You have the flexibility to code in your style by deploying any container that responds to events or requests. Applications can be created using your chosen language and dependencies, allowing for deployment in mere seconds. Cloud Run automatically adjusts resources, scaling up or down from zero based on incoming traffic, while only charging for the resources actually consumed. This innovative approach simplifies the processes of app development and deployment, enhancing overall efficiency. Additionally, Cloud Run is fully integrated with tools such as Cloud Code, Cloud Build, Cloud Monitoring, and Cloud Logging, further enriching the developer experience and enabling smoother workflows. By leveraging these integrations, developers can streamline their processes and ensure a more cohesive development environment.

JS7 JobSchedulerJS7 JobScheduler is an open-source workload automation platform engineered for both high performance and durability. It adheres to cutting-edge security protocols, enabling limitless capacity for executing jobs and workflows in parallel. Additionally, JS7 facilitates cross-platform job execution and managed file transfers while supporting intricate dependencies without requiring any programming skills. The JS7 REST-API streamlines automation for inventory management and job oversight, enhancing operational efficiency. Capable of managing thousands of agents simultaneously across diverse platforms, JS7 truly excels in its versatility. Platforms supported by JS7 range from cloud environments like Docker®, OpenShift®, and Kubernetes® to traditional on-premises setups, accommodating systems such as Windows®, Linux®, AIX®, Solaris®, and macOS®. Moreover, it seamlessly integrates hybrid cloud and on-premises functionalities, making it adaptable to various organizational needs. The user interface of JS7 features a contemporary GUI that embraces a no-code methodology for managing inventory, monitoring, and controlling operations through web browsers. It provides near-real-time updates, ensuring immediate visibility into status changes and job log outputs. With multi-client support and role-based access management, users can confidently navigate the system, which also includes OIDC authentication and LDAP integration for enhanced security. In terms of high availability, JS7 guarantees redundancy and resilience through its asynchronous architecture and self-managing agents, while the clustering of all JS7 products enables automatic failover and manual switch-over capabilities, ensuring uninterrupted service. This comprehensive approach positions JS7 as a robust solution for organizations seeking dependable workload automation.

WindocksWindocks offers customizable, on-demand access to databases like Oracle and SQL Server, tailored for various purposes such as Development, Testing, Reporting, Machine Learning, and DevOps. Their database orchestration facilitates a seamless, code-free automated delivery process that encompasses features like data masking, synthetic data generation, Git operations, access controls, and secrets management. Users can deploy databases to traditional instances, Kubernetes, or Docker containers, enhancing flexibility and scalability. Installation of Windocks can be accomplished on standard Linux or Windows servers in just a few minutes, and it is compatible with any public cloud platform or on-premise system. One virtual machine can support as many as 50 simultaneous database environments, and when integrated with Docker containers, enterprises frequently experience a notable 5:1 decrease in the number of lower-level database VMs required. This efficiency not only optimizes resource usage but also accelerates development and testing cycles significantly.

Inuvika OVD EnterpriseInuvika OVD Enterprise offers a robust desktop virtualization platform that allows users to securely access their applications and virtual desktops from any location. Adhering to the zero-trust principle, Inuvika guarantees secure access while ensuring that no data is stored on user devices. This solution simplifies administrative tasks and can lower the overall total cost of ownership by up to 60% when compared to alternatives like Citrix or VMware/Omnissa Horizon. OVD Enterprise can be implemented either on-premises or through any private or public cloud service provider, and it is also available as a Desktop as a Service (DaaS) offering via its network of Managed Services Providers. The installation and management of OVD are straightforward, and it seamlessly integrates with popular enterprise standards, including various directory services, storage systems, and hypervisors such as Proxmox VE, vSphere, Nutanix AHV, and Hyper-V. Key Features include: - Compatibility with any device, including macOS, Windows, Linux, iOS/Android, Chromebook, Raspberry Pi, or any HTML5 web browser. - Support for multi-tenancy. - Integrated Two-Factor Authentication for enhanced security. - An Integrated Gateway that allows secure remote access without the need for a VPN. - A single web-based admin console for simplified management. - Deployment on Linux, which means that most Microsoft Windows server and SQL server licenses are unnecessary. - Hypervisor agnosticism, supporting platforms like Proxmox VE, Hyper-V, vSphere, KVM, Nutanix AHV, and more. With its extensive range of features and capabilities, OVD Enterprise is designed to meet the diverse needs of modern businesses while providing a secure and efficient virtual desktop experience.
